<p>I opened a Vodacom data contract - really good deal in my mind - @ R299 pm topup contract for 10GB anytime data. In the middle of the month, I received a notification that I had a bill of R1500, and that I was on a R499 pm OPEN contract with 10GB night owl data. </p> <p> </p> <p>This is NOT what I signed for. I went to the store where I took out the contract - they could not even give me the original contract that I signed for. They promised to get back to me but never did. I have called customer service to launch a query. </p> <p> </p> <p>So for now, I am without internet, with an apparantly huge bill which I cannot pay for, no apoligies from Vodacom and no visible attempt to rectify the problem. </p>
